Helen Munro

Head of Environment & Sustainability

Helen prides herself in ensuring our clients know that we are adapting to the rapid physical and cultural changes happening worldwide, meaning we are playing our part in protecting the planet. She is experienced in shaping business operations to ‘do it better’ and focuses on optimising our response to sustainability emergencies, whilst also connecting the day-to-day with wider environmental principles.
Helen Munro

Personalise your content

Sign up for the latest news, events and thought leadership